EON Gaming has announced another version of its 'XBHD' adapter; a plug-and-play device that allows for HDMI-powered high definition gaming on the original Xbox. This new version carries over all the 2023 edition's features - except this time it's housed in a beautiful 'Halo Spartan Edition' green casing.

The new Spartan-flavoured adapter features 480i, 480p, 720p and 1080i playback, LAN connectivity, a 3.5mm audio jack, and multiple HDMI slots for multiscreen play - as you can see in the images. It's important to note that the XBHD adapter only works with US NTSC systems.

Late last year we reviewed the first-edition XBHD, and ultimately came away a little disappointed. However, the biggest issue we had — the adapter's overall display brightness — is said to have been resolved on new units, and the fixed units have now seen a price cut too - cost being our other major concern when reviewing the XBHD.

Anyway, both this new Halo Spartan Edition and the standard black adapters now come in at $149.99 — down from the original $189.99 asking price — and if you'd like to read our impressions, feel free to check those out down below. Just be aware that the brightness issues we faced are supposedly now fixed!
